Instructions
To start Properly you need a proper kombuis helmet (stirring Bowl) and a lekker mozie net (Sift)
add cake powder & lig jou koek (Baking Powder)
and definitely add some Crazy Warrie Spice, make sure you put enough of Crazy Warrie Spice just for some gees.
and then some Garlic & Lemon Hand Grenade
Then shake it around like a rooi kop laatjie wat chappies gesteel het. make it nice and fluffy.
next take one poering bowl, and mix the 4 hoender bout vrugte (eggs)
use a garden fork(table fork) and wack it
now take your treinspoor bum fruit (eggs) and poor it into your crazy mix
now add the proudly South African chakalaka with sweetcorn
mix it all together and make it as confused as a poep in n warelwind
take one decent size water krip (baking Pan) and spry it with liquid botter (Cook n Bake, Non-stick Spray)
pour in your liquid brootjie
to top it off add some gestolde kooi tet (chees)
pop it into mamma se koekie cremator (oven) at 180deg for 35min
